Output 034ff7e8eb7033003cbe14a709b3b7652d0e1b47657a6a600b10b73cd71b44aa:3

value
28997527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b854de7014170508b22598a2a6d2164b566313 OP_EQUAL
address
MFtyqhS3PWA1aRPDmaVZH9YRHeSKNnmkPP
transaction
034ff7e8eb7033003cbe14a709b3b7652d0e1b47657a6a600b10b73cd71b44aa
spent
true